Fratello Blu Toro Cigar Review

Fratello Blu Toro Cigar Review – This 6×50 stick features a very thick, oily and toothy dark cocoa wrapper with minimal veins, tight invisible seams, large double cap and musty mushroom aroma.  First light reveals a good draw with vegetal notes, on the smooth side, with a long finish.  The first third comes up to a medium body with flavors of the same grassiness with alight coffee and hazelnut joining in.  The finish is long with the same.  The 1/2 way point comes at 30 minutes dropping a solid ash.  The draw improved putting out more smoke, sticking with a long finish and medium bodied flavors.  It shifts to a straight light coffee with just a bit of the nuttiness lingering.  Ending at 55 minutes to the hot nub the last third swaps the coffee and nuttiness in intensity while the draw improves to perfect.
